Static task
static1
Behavioral task
behavioral1
Sample
2024-04-25_1b587f0c0cd241bd0764a6b1e114b154_icedid.exe
Resource
win7-20240221-en
Behavioral task
behavioral2
Sample
2024-04-25_1b587f0c0cd241bd0764a6b1e114b154_icedid.exe
Resource
win10v2004-20240412-en
General
-
Target
2024-04-25_1b587f0c0cd241bd0764a6b1e114b154_icedid
-
Size
1.3MB
-
MD5
1b587f0c0cd241bd0764a6b1e114b154
-
SHA1
11649084ed436161da5007fff531a7e6f3eef7d5
-
SHA256
c7d3c78b86b280347b76e4174578f340e5c6a9fc100db014fe584e43a198103c
-
SHA512
96a0cb90e74ef5cae3f524b95130a80a2850369d3c84fb51f90782c10fd8f4e4dd1ee660d25a32eba540d5044b46cdbdc80e21279c3e4b7fb548bd64c432a8cf
-
SSDEEP
12288:bGbVrl3aei2Tas0WoMjIq9/XnkEpSE0xgoNKA33g:bGbVMhWjIq9/XnX0xgog
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ource 2024-04-25_1b587f0c0cd241bd0764a6b1e114b154_icedid
Files
-
2024-04-25_1b587f0c0cd241bd0764a6b1e114b154_icedid.exe windows:5 windows x86 arch:x86
4404a6f281a443cf8d6b68fadd550859
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_TERMINAL_SERVER_AWARE
File Characteristics
IMAGE_FILE_RELOCS_STRIPPED
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
Imports
setupapi
SetupDiEnumDeviceInfo
SetupDiGetDeviceInstanceIdA
SetupDiGetClassDevsA
SetupDiEnumDeviceInterfaces
SetupDiGetDeviceInterfaceDetailA
SetupDiGetDeviceRegistryPropertyA
SetupDiDestroyDeviceInfoList
ftd2xx
ord30
ord80
ord2
ord70
ord71
ord1
instdll
InstGetHiddenParameters
InstUutPowerOn
InstGetUsbCurrent
InstGetTpVoltage
InstUutPowerOff
InstConnectUsb
InstStartPogoBed
InstAssignBedNumber
InstEndPogoBed
InstProgramPic32
InstGetFirmVersions
InstGetDllVersions
InstGetErrorMessage
InstGetPogoBedList
InstSetPowerSource
kernel32
DuplicateHandle
GetCurrentProcess
GetVolumeInformationA
GetFullPathNameA
TlsGetValue
GlobalReAlloc
GlobalHandle
TlsAlloc
TlsSetValue
LocalReAlloc
TlsFree
GetModuleHandleW
GlobalFlags
FileTimeToLocalFileTime
GetFileSizeEx
GetFileTime
GetCPInfo
GetOEMCP
SetErrorMode
GetCurrentThread
RaiseException
GetTimeFormatA
GetDateFormatA
TerminateProcess
UnhandledExceptionFilter
SetUnhandledExceptionFilter
IsDebuggerPresent
GetSystemTimeAsFileTime
HeapAlloc
GetCommandLineA
GetStartupInfoA
HeapFree
VirtualProtect
VirtualAlloc
GetSystemInfo
VirtualQuery
HeapReAlloc
SetStdHandle
GetFileType
ExitProcess
ExitThread
HeapSize
GetACP
IsValidCodePage
GetStringTypeA
GetStringTypeW
LCMapStringA
LCMapStringW
GetTimeZoneInformation
GetStdHandle
VirtualFree
HeapCreate
FreeEnvironmentStringsA
GetEnvironmentStrings
FreeEnvironmentStringsW
GetEnvironmentStringsW
SetHandleCount
QueryPerformanceCounter
InitializeCriticalSectionAndSpinCount
GetConsoleCP
GetConsoleMode
GetExitCodeProcess
WriteConsoleA
GetConsoleOutputCP
WriteConsoleW
CompareStringW
SetEnvironmentVariableA
ConvertDefaultLocale
EnumResourceLanguagesA
GetProcessHeap
GetFileSize
InterlockedExchange
FreeResource
GetCurrentThreadId
GlobalGetAtomNameA
GlobalAddAtomA
GlobalFindAtomA
GlobalDeleteAtom
CompareStringA
lstrcmpW
GetCurrentProcessId
GetModuleFileNameA
GetModuleHandleA
FileTimeToSystemTime
GetThreadLocale
GlobalFree
GlobalAlloc
GlobalLock
GlobalUnlock
SetLastError
WaitForMultipleObjects
GetTickCount
lstrcmpA
GetCommTimeouts
GetCommState
SetCommState
SetupComm
EscapeCommFunction
ClearCommError
SetCommTimeouts
WriteFile
TerminateThread
GetFileAttributesA
LocalFree
InitializeCriticalSection
EnterCriticalSection
LeaveCriticalSection
DeleteCriticalSection
MulDiv
lstrcpyA
LoadLibraryA
FreeLibrary
CreateDirectoryA
CopyFileA
FindClose
FindFirstFileA
FindNextFileA
GetSystemTime
lstrcpynA
WritePrivateProfileStringA
GetPrivateProfileStringA
CreateThread
GetPrivateProfileIntA
GetExitCodeThread
Sleep
GetProcAddress
CreateMutexA
CreatePipe
CreateProcessA
WaitForSingleObject
ReadFile
GetLocalTime
GetVersionExA
CreateFileA
CloseHandle
GetLastError
InterlockedDecrement
FormatMessageA
lstrlenA
LocalAlloc
MultiByteToWideChar
WideCharToMultiByte
InterlockedIncrement
FindResourceA
LoadResource
LockResource
SizeofResource
SetEndOfFile
UnlockFile
LockFile
FlushFileBuffers
SetFilePointer
DeleteFileA
GetModuleFileNameW
CreateEventA
SuspendThread
SetEvent
ResumeThread
GetLocaleInfoA
SetThreadPriority
RtlUnwind
user32
GetNextDlgGroupItem
MessageBeep
UnregisterClassA
SetCapture
InvalidateRgn
IsRectEmpty
CopyAcceleratorTableA
LoadCursorA
GetSysColorBrush
CharUpperA
WindowFromPoint
DrawFocusRect
DestroyMenu
SetWindowContextHelpId
MapDialogRect
RegisterClipboardFormatA
SetRectEmpty
SetCursor
GetMessageA
GetCursorPos
ValidateRect
PostQuitMessage
GetDesktopWindow
GetActiveWindow
CreateDialogIndirectParamA
GetNextDlgTabItem
EndDialog
CharNextA
ShowWindow
SetWindowTextA
IsDialogMessageA
SetDlgItemTextA
SetMenuItemBitmaps
GetMenuCheckMarkDimensions
LoadBitmapA
ModifyMenuA
CheckMenuItem
RegisterWindowMessageA
SendDlgItemMessageA
WinHelpA
IsChild
GetCapture
SetWindowsHookExA
CallNextHookEx
GetClassLongA
PostThreadMessageA
SetPropA
GetPropA
RemovePropA
SetFocus
GetForegroundWindow
SetActiveWindow
BeginDeferWindowPos
EndDeferWindowPos
GetDlgItem
GetTopWindow
DestroyWindow
UnhookWindowsHookEx
GetMessageTime
MapWindowPoints
TrackPopupMenu
SetMenu
SetForegroundWindow
GetClassInfoExA
GetClassInfoA
RegisterClassA
AdjustWindowRectEx
EqualRect
DeferWindowPos
CopyRect
DefWindowProcA
CallWindowProcA
GetMenu
SetWindowLongA
OffsetRect
IntersectRect
GetWindowPlacement
GetWindow
GetWindowThreadProcessId
GetWindowLongA
EnableWindow
SendMessageA
GetWindowRect
IsWindowVisible
SetTimer
GetLastActivePopup
IsWindowEnabled
GetWindowDC
ClientToScreen
ScreenToClient
GrayStringA
DrawTextExA
DrawTextA
TabbedTextOutA
FillRect
GetWindowTextLengthA
GetWindowTextA
GetMenuState
GetClassNameA
ReleaseCapture
GetFocus
GetDlgCtrlID
MessageBoxA
PostMessageA
GetParent
DispatchMessageA
TranslateMessage
GetClientRect
GetKeyState
EnableMenuItem
GetMenuItemID
GetSubMenu
LoadMenuA
RedrawWindow
KillTimer
SetWindowPos
DrawIcon
IsIconic
BeginPaint
EndPaint
GetDC
GetUpdateRect
GetSystemMetrics
PtInRect
SetRect
UpdateWindow
InvalidateRect
IsWindow
LoadImageA
PeekMessageA
ReleaseDC
CreateWindowExA
AppendMenuA
RemoveMenu
GetSystemMenu
LoadIconA
GetSysColor
SystemParametersInfoA
wsprintfA
GetMenuItemCount
MoveWindow
GetMessagePos
gdi32
ExtSelectClipRgn
DeleteDC
OffsetViewportOrgEx
CreateBitmap
CreateCompatibleDC
GetBkColor
GetTextColor
CreateRectRgnIndirect
GetCharWidthA
StretchDIBits
CreateCompatibleBitmap
GetTextMetricsA
GetMapMode
GetRgnBox
ScaleWindowExtEx
SetWindowExtEx
ScaleViewportExtEx
StartPage
StartDocA
GetDeviceCaps
CreateFontIndirectA
CreateSolidBrush
Rectangle
GetTextExtentPoint32A
CreateFontA
SetViewportOrgEx
Escape
ExtTextOutA
TextOutA
RectVisible
PtVisible
BitBlt
GetWindowExtEx
GetViewportExtEx
DeleteObject
IntersectClipRect
ExcludeClipRect
GetClipBox
SetMapMode
SetTextColor
SetBkMode
SetBkColor
RestoreDC
SaveDC
GetStockObject
SelectObject
GetObjectA
EndDoc
EndPage
SetViewportExtEx
comdlg32
GetFileTitleA
winspool.drv
DocumentPropertiesA
ClosePrinter
OpenPrinterA
advapi32
RegCreateKeyExA
RegQueryValueA
RegOpenKeyA
RegEnumKeyA
RegDeleteKeyA
RegSetValueExA
RegEnumKeyExA
RegOpenKeyExA
RegQueryValueExA
RegCloseKey
shell32
ShellExecuteA
shlwapi
PathFindFileNameA
PathStripToRootA
PathIsUNCA
SHGetValueA
PathFindExtensionA
oledlg
ord8
ole32
CoRevokeClassObject
CreateILockBytesOnHGlobal
StgCreateDocfileOnILockBytes
StgOpenStorageOnILockBytes
CoGetClassObject
CLSIDFromProgID
OleInitialize
CoFreeUnusedLibraries
OleUninitialize
CLSIDFromString
CoTaskMemFree
CoInitialize
CoUninitialize
CoCreateInstance
OleRun
OleIsCurrentClipboard
OleFlushClipboard
CoRegisterMessageFilter
CoTaskMemAlloc
oleaut32
VariantChangeType
SysAllocString
SysAllocStringByteLen
SysStringByteLen
SysFreeString
VariantInit
VariantCopy
VariantClear
SysAllocStringLen
VarUdateFromDate
SysStringLen
SafeArrayDestroy
VariantTimeToSystemTime
SystemTimeToVariantTime
OleCreateFontIndirect
GetErrorInfo
Sections
.text Size: 553KB - Virtual size: 552K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 137KB - Virtual size: 137K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 14KB - Virtual size: 289K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 586KB - Virtual size: 585K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